CPU/Disk Drive Troubleshooting
Disk Drive Recovery Process
Using the Instrument Recovery System
1. Make sure the instrument is turned off.
2. Turn on the instrument.
3. After the “Agilent Technologies” screen is displayed the following screen
contents will be displayed for 5 seconds.
Figure 8-1
4. Press the down arrow key to move the highlight to “Agilent Recovery
System”, press the Enter key.
5. When the Agilent Recovery System has booted, follow the on-screen
instructions to recover the image of the C drive.
6. After exiting the Agilent Recovery System, the instrument will reboot a few
times.
7. Update the X-Series software to the latest version by downloading it from
the following URL:
www.keysight.com/find/xseries_software
